The purpose of guiding is not only to help people to catch fish but ultimately to better enable them to catch fish themselves through relating an understanding of exactly why the fish are caught in terms of technique and presentation for the circumstances. To teach and fine tune fishing techniques such as for instance Irish Lough style short line wet fly fishing for trout or salmon, or furrowing mini tubes, or pulsating Irish shrimp flies while retrieving line on a salmon river.

There is a long term learning curve involved in wild game fish angling, as there is in Fly-Casting and experience counts greatly. The greatest way to shorten the learning curve is to learn from the already experienced. Game Angling is also a country sport with an associated sporting tradition and etiquette.

For me the Atlantic salmon is the most perfect fish for the Game Angler. Atlantic salmon are heavily influenced by prevailing water and weather conditions and their physical surroundings. In Atlantic Salmon angling understanding the influence of water and weather conditions and other factors such as riverbed topography and currents on the fish, and on methods and techniques is often critical to success.
